java
文章平均质量分 89
昕鸿
书山有路勤为径 学海无涯苦作舟
展开
-
JAXB解析生成xml
1、简介 JAXB(Java Architecture for XML Binding) 是一个业界的标准,是一项可以根据XML Schema产生Java类的技术。JAXB 已经是jdk的组成部分,不需要另外引入jar包 2、几个核心注解 (1)@XmlRootElement(name = "response") 将Java类或枚举类型映射到XML元素。 (2) @Xml原创 2017-04-28 15:39:51 · 1622 阅读 · 0 评论 -
mongodb+GridFS文件的上传下载删除
1、背景 最近项目使用mongDB做文件服务器,用于文件存储。所以稍微研究了下mongDB API写了个简单文件上传下载删除示例 2、具体代码 完整demo下载路径: 代码中有完整注释。这里就不一一赘述了。我这里使用的是fileupload做的上传。这里是使用的jar: 代码是用servlet写的,有点长。 package com.yqfz.Servlet; import原创 2017-05-19 14:09:18 · 11775 阅读 · 2 评论 -
使用Filter过滤器,控制不能直接访问JSP文件
1、背景 项目中有时候会把jsp直接放在webroot下面。又不想让用户直接通过在地址栏键入jsp页面来访问。 这时候处理方式有2中: (1)将JSP放在WEB-INF 下面。这是最简单的方式(不过很多人觉得这种方式目录结构不好看) (2)将JSP放在webRoot下面,写个过滤器来过滤一下 第一种方法就不多说了,不要改动任何代码。这里简单说下第二种过滤器的写法 2、过滤器过滤jsp原创 2017-05-27 09:58:58 · 4099 阅读 · 0 评论 -
FastJSON,将对象或数组和JSON串互转
Fastjson,是阿里巴巴提供的一个Java语言编写的高性能功能完善的JSON库。 其开源的下载网址为:https://github.com/alibaba/fastjson。 示例代码如下: [java] view plain copy package test; import java.util.ArrayList; i转载 2017-07-20 14:19:12 · 1482 阅读 · 0 评论